Overview
HizliFX is a forex broker registered in Turkey and established on April 12, 2021. The company operates under the domain hizlifx125.com and lists a registered address in Luxembourg at Banzelt 4 A, 6921 Roodt-sur-Syre. The broker's website and social media presence suggest it targets retail traders, but independent public information about its operations is extremely limited.
According to FXCanary's records, HizliFX has no known regulators on file, which is a significant red flag for traders seeking a trustworthy brokerage. The broker's presence on Facebook, Instagram, Twitter/X, and YouTube indicates an attempt to build a client base through social media marketing.
Regulation and Safety
HizliFX does not hold any financial regulatory licenses from recognized authorities. The absence of regulation means there is no external oversight of the broker's operations, client fund segregation, or dispute resolution mechanisms. This lack of regulatory protection exposes traders to elevated risk, including potential fraud or mismanagement of funds.
FXCanary's Scam Risk Score for HizliFX is 85 out of 100, classified as 'Severe'. This high score reflects the broker's unregulated status, limited public track record, and the mismatch between its Turkish registration and Luxembourg address. Traders are strongly advised to avoid depositing funds with unregulated brokers.
Account Types
HizliFX offers three account tiers: Silver, Gold, and Platin. The Silver and Gold accounts require a minimum deposit of 100 TL, while the Platin account requires a significantly higher minimum deposit of 5,000 USD. This account structure suggests the broker caters to both small retail traders and higher-net-worth individuals.
All account types offer a maximum leverage of 1:500, which is extremely high and typical of unregulated brokers. Such leverage can amplify both profits and losses, and is generally restricted or prohibited by regulated financial authorities. The difference in base currency for deposits (TL vs. USD) indicates that the broker may primarily target Turkish residents but also accept international clients.
